Seasteps is an inviting and spacious townhouse located in Fowey, Cornwall, boasting a picturesque waterside setting along the River Fowey. The accommodation is thoughtfully arranged over four floors, providing ample space for families or groups, with the capacity to sleep up to eight guests plus one infant. Its prime location ensures easy access to a variety of local amenities, making it an ideal base for exploring this charming small town.
Fowey is renowned for its vibrant atmosphere, featuring a delightful array of shops, independent restaurants, pubs, and galleries that reflect the town's unique character. Guests can enjoy a leisurely 15-minute walk to the nearby sheltered beach at Readymoney Cove, where they can relax by the sea. The area offers numerous outdoor activities, including scenic creek walks, fishing trips, and kayaking adventures, with opportunities to visit nearby villages such as Polruan and Mevagissey via ferry.
In addition to its local attractions, Seasteps is conveniently located for visits to significant landmarks such as the Eden Project and The Lost Gardens of Heligan, both just a short drive away. The surrounding region is rich with beautiful beaches and National Trust properties, including the historic Lanhydrock House, providing guests with a variety of experiences to enhance their stay.
The property features a narrow walled garden, accessible by a flight of steps, which leads to a platform and steps down to the river and foreshore, perfect for enjoying the outdoor environment. Guests can take advantage of the provided barbecue and furniture for a delightful al fresco dining experience. While there is no parking available directly with the property, the nearest long-stay car park is located 300 yards away at Caffa Mill, ensuring convenient access for visitors.
